SchoolInsight Basic & Yearly Setup
This introductory course covers the basics of getting your
school up and running with SchoolInsight. Topics include:
setting up student data, managing instructor accounts,
creating courses and rosters, custom reporting, yearly setup,
sending emails, and more. By the end of this session,
attendees will be comfortable with how to use SchoolInsight
in their daily work. This course includes hands-on labs
where attendees use their actual school data. This course is
intended for new SchoolInsight customers.
SchoolInsight Attendance (Self-Contained)
This course covers the essentials of managing attendance
for schools with self-contained classrooms. Learn how to
maintain the official attendance record, take and import
daily attendance, run reports, customize attendance codes,
and more. After completing this course, users will have the
skills needed to effectively manage their entire attendance
program. This course is intended for new users responsible
for school attendance.

SchoolInsight Manual Scheduling
This introductory course will guide you step-by-step
through the manual scheduling process. It helps new customers
feel comfortable using the scheduler. By the end of this
course, attendees will have the skills needed to manually
build conflict-free master and student schedules. Learn how
to schedule rooms, instructors, and students. Team scheduling
and different cycle days (M-F, A/B, block, etc.) will also be
covered in this class. This course is intended for those
beginning the scheduling process with SchoolInsight.
SchoolInsight Advanced Scheduling
This course will guide you step-by-step through the
advanced scheduling process. It familiarizes customers with
using course registration and automatedschedule generation.
By the end of this course, attendees will have the skills
needed to produce conflict-free master and student schedules.
Learn how to utilize student course requests and instructor
qualifications to generate complex schedules. Handling
special scheduling situations and tracking students’
graduation requirements will also be covered in this class.
This course is intended for those beginning the advanced
scheduling process with SchoolInsight. We recommend
completing ‘SchoolInsight Manual Scheduling’, or being
familiar with those concepts, prior to taking this course.
